Indore, Madhya Pradesh vs Prachin Buri Climate & Distance Between

Thailand flag
  • The distance between Indore, Madhya Pradesh, India and Prachin Buri, Thailand is approximately 2,860 km or 1,777 mi.
  • To reach Indore, Madhya Pradesh in this distance one would set out from Prachin Buri bearing 293.4°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Indore, Madhya Pradesh bearing 285.2° or WNW .
  •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Indore, Madhya Pradesh is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Prachin Buri is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
  • The mean temperature is 3.4 °C (6.1°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.2 °C (18.4°F) more in Indore, Madhya Pradesh.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 947 mm (37.3 in) less which is equivalent to 947 l/m² (23.24 US gal/ft²) or 9,470,000 l/ha (1,012,406 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.1° lower in Indore, Madhya Pradesh than in Prachin Buri.
